Studying Online at Amberton University
Many students take online classes at Amberton University. Among 892 students, 577 (65%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 260 (29%) took at least some classes online.

Accounting Master’s Program at Amberton University
Among the 6 master’s accounting graduates at Amberton University, 83% were women (5) and 17% were men (1).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Accounting master’s degree recipients at Amberton University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 3 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
| Asian | 1 |
Minority students account for 50% of Accounting master’s degree recipients at Amberton University, above the national average of 35%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
